Transaction 95cd5130dcd771d8d712a096d50e9528ab646716504f589976733481f2f228e7

1 Input
1 Outputs
  • 95cd5130dcd771d8d712a096d50e9528ab646716504f589976733481f2f228e7:0
  • value  80520
    address  bc1quy0c7hcehzluuyxycx22z7ztjv32atqdlj2wxt